Harbour Door Services has been serving Victoria and the surrounding area since 1986, providing sales and service of overhead doors, electric door operators and residential and commercial gate systems.
Our track record of success attracted the attention of Dakwakada Capital Investments (DCI), which purchased Harbour Door Services in 2022, further strengthening its presence in the overhead door sector, which includes overhead door companies in Kelowna, BC and Whitehorse, Yukon. DCI is a privately owned investment firm in Whitehorse, Yukon that owns and operates a portfolio of business assets for the Champagne and Aishihik First Nations (CAFN).
